  • Photo of Boko Haram: Governor Zulum receives another Chibok schoolgirl with her kids in Gwoza

    Boko Haram: Governor Zulum receives another Chibok schoolgirl with her kids in Gwoza

    Borno State Governor, Babagana Umara Zulum, on Saturday in Gwoza, received another Chibok Girl who presented herself to the Nigerian Army. The schoolgirl, Hassana Adamu, alongside her two children, was handed over to Governor Zulum by the Commander, 26 Taskforce Brigade, Brigadier General DR Dantani. Zulum was in Gwoza from there he moved to Bama, undertaking humanitarian activities. He had just returned from northern Borno where he spent five days for humanitarian interventions. Hassana was one of over 200 schoolgirls abducted at a Government Secondary School in Chibok on April 14, 2014, by Boko Haram insurgents. It can be recalled…

  • Photo of IPOB suspends sit-at-home order

    IPOB suspends sit-at-home order

    The Indigenous People of Biafra(IPOB) has suspended the weekly sit-at-home exercise it commenced this week in the southeast. This was according to a statement by the group’s Spokesperson Emma Powerful, on Saturday. IPOB had declared a weekly sit-at-home exercise to protest the arrest and detention of its leader, Nnamdi Kanu by the Federal Government. The exercise, which commenced on Monday, August 9, was trailed by loss of lives, property as well as huge financial and economic implications for the region. The group said the suspension of the exercise is due to a direct order from Kanu to that effect. It…
